Why flexible fuel hoses are a game changer for industrial burner systems

Flexible fuel lines are revolutionizing the operation of industrial burner systems, providing a range of benefits that make them an industry revolution. These pipes are capable of holding a variety of different fuel sources, including natural gas, propane, and even biofuels, making them incredibly versatile and efficient.

One of the main advantages of flexible fuel lines is their ability to optimize burner operation. By being able to use multiple fuel sources, these pipes can adapt to changing fuel conditions and ensure the burner always operates at maximum efficiency. This not only reduces operating costs, but also minimizes emissions and improves overall performance.

Additionally, flexible fuel hoses are also incredibly reliable and durable, making them ideal for use in industrial environments where they are exposed to harsh conditions. These pipes are designed to withstand high temperatures, pressures and corrosive materials, ensuring that they will last for many years without requiring frequent maintenance or replacement.

Another important benefit of flexible fuel lines is their ability to reduce greenhouse gas emissions and improve sustainability. By being able to use a variety of fuel sources, industrial burner systems can reduce their reliance on fossil fuels and shift to cleaner, more renewable energy sources. This not only helps protect the environment, but also ensures compliance with increasingly strict emissions regulations.
